There is no way to force community metadata at the top, no. Voyager avoids pushing content below the fold, it’s Voyagers design philosophy. You can access that info by opening the sidebar if you like.

This is the best part of Lemmy though, there are lots of apps to choose from to fit your taste.

If just find if jarring because you’re used to another apps UX, I recommend giving it time to get used to.
